A boat dive to Nemo Reef, named for the clownfish and anemones that make it one of Havelock’s most colourful sites for beginners and certified divers alike.

A short boat ride from Havelock to the Nemo Reef site, with your safety briefing along the way.
Fitting gear and a calm, shallow confidence check before heading to the reef itself.
A guided dive along the reef spotting clownfish, anemones, and reef fish.
Certification: not required for the introductory version of this dive — first-timers from around age 10 are typically welcomed, with the dive kept to roughly 4–10 metres depth.
Best for: both first-time and certified divers looking for an easy, colourful reef.
